Correlations between the factor M(3000)F2 and several indices of solar
activity show that - independently of the kind of index, location and
season - there occurs a significant hysteresis. The same holds for
correlations between M(3000)F2 and f0F2. Apparently the sense of
rotation changes irregularly and depends on the cycle number.
